Cable model yjlw is a high-quality and reliable cable widely used in the telecommunications industry. This article provides a detailed explanation of Cable model yjlw, focusing on its structure, features, applications, and advantages.
Cable model yjlw is composed of several layers that ensure its durability and performance. The innermost layer is the conductor made of high-quality copper or aluminum, which provides excellent conductivity for transmitting signals. Surrounding the conductor is an insulation layer made of polyethylene or PVC material to protect against electrical interference.
The next layer is the metallic shield made of aluminum or copper tape to provide additional protection against electromagnetic interference (EMI) and radio frequency interference (RFI). On top of the metallic shield lies another insulation layer known as bedding, which further enhances protection against external factors such as moisture and mechanical stress.
The outermost layer is the sheath made from flame-retardant materials like polyvinyl chloride (PVC) or low-smoke zero-halogen (LSZH), ensuring safety in case of fire incidents. The overall structure guarantees optimal performance and longevity for Cable model yjlw.
Cable model yjlw possesses several notable features that make it stand out in the market:
a) High Transmission Capacity: Cable model yjlw has a high transmission capacity due to its excellent conductivity provided by quality conductors like copper or aluminum.
b) Resistance to Interference: With its multiple layers including metallic shields, Cable model yjlw offers exceptional resistance to electromagnetic interference (EMI) and radio frequency interference (RFI).
c) Durability: The robust construction ensures that Cable model yjlw can withstand harsh environmental conditions such as extreme temperatures, moisture, chemicals, abrasion, etc., making it suitable for both indoor and outdoor installations.
